How do you seal fabric markers on shoes?

Hold the waterproofing fabric spray at least 6 inches from the canvas and spray in long, even strokes. Spray the entire shoe, not just the area where you applied the permanent marker. If the entire shoe is not sprayed, it will stain and wear unevenly.

Does Sharpie come off of Air Force Ones?

Rubbing alcohol from the local drugstore removes ink from all types of shoes, as it makes the ink liquid again. The trick is to apply the alcohol with a cotton swab, paper towel, or a white cleaning cloth that can absorb the ink pigment; otherwise, the ink just stays on the shoes.

Should I use fabric or acrylic paint on shoes?

Acrylic paint can be used on fabric effectively however it won’t last long so it needs a special fabric medium so it sticks and adheres better to fabric. If you are painting shoes and you want your paint last, I would definitely use Fabric paint for this type of surface.

What kind of markers do you use to draw on fabric?

Get a set of permanent, fabric, chalk ink, or acrylic markers in a variety of colors. That way, you’ll have lots of options when deciding on a color palette. Thin-tip markers will lend maximum precision to your designs without much bleeding. Black markers are useful in tracing designs.
